About this episode
Ever wonder how industries impact dietary and health guidelines? We start with the influence of Big Sugar. This episode features audio from
How Big Sugar Undermines Dietary Guidelines
and
How Big Sugar Manipulated the Science for Dietary Guidelines
. Visit the video pages for all sources and doctor's notes related to this podcast.
